Dr. Powers is a graduate of the University of Michigan, earning a BS in Chemistry in 1967 and a PhD in Dental Materials and Mechanical Engineering in 1972. He was a professor at the University of Michigan School Of Dentistry from 1972 to 1988 and at the University of Texas Dental Branch at Houston from 1988 to 2005. He is currently Professor of Oral Biomaterials at the University of Texas Dental Branch at Houston as well as Senior Vice-President of Dental Consultants, Inc. Dr. Powers co-founded THE DENTAL ADVISOR in 1983, and continues his role as Editor of the publication.
Dr. Powers is a member of the American Association for Dental Research and the American Dental Education Association. He is also a fellow of the Academy of Dental Materials.
Dr. Powers is an investigator on scientific protocols evaluating adhesives, composites, impression materials, and cements. Dr. Powers has authored more than 980 scientific publications. He is editor/author of three books: Craig's Restorative Dental Materials, Dental Materials - Properties and Manipulation, and Esthetic Color Training in Dentistry. He lectures internationally on research in dental materials.

Dr. John McLaren has a practice in Midland, Michigan. Dr. McLaren is dedicated to the providing his patients with the highest quality dentistry using the most modern techniques. His interest is in full-mouth rehabilitation and implant dentistry. Dr. McLaren is a three-time graduate of the University of Michigan School of Dentistry (Materials Science Engineering, Doctor of Dental Surgery, Masters in Restorative Dentistry). His scientific background has helped him to bridge the gap between technology and clinical practice. Dr. McLaren has conducted research in reducing mercury vapor release from amalgam, strengthening of porcelain, color matching of composites, and high-tech fiber-reinforced materials. Dr. McLaren has taught pre-clinical dentistry, oral medicine and diagnosis, and holds the position of Adjunct Clinical Assistant Professor of Dentistry at the University of Michigan. He is also an Associate Editor of THE DENTAL ADVISOR, has given numerous lectures as well as writing published articles and book chapters. Dr. McLaren is a member of the American Dental Association, Michigan Dental Association, Academy of Operative Dentistry, Omicron Kappa Upsilon (honorary dental society), Phi Kappa Phi, Alpha Sigma Mu (National Metallurgical Materials Society), and Saginaw Valley District Dental Society.
